## Career Opportunity Review: Care Assistant at Richmond Village Letcombe Regis This review provides a comprehensive overview of the Care Assistant position at Richmond Village Letcombe Regis, aimed at helping prospective candidates understand the opportunity and its potential impact on their career journey.

Richmond Village Letcombe Regis, a Bupa-owned luxury retirement village in Oxfordshire, is seeking dedicated and compassionate Care Assistants to join their esteemed team. This role offers a rewarding opportunity to make a significant difference in the lives of residents, promoting their independence and well-being within a high-quality, supportive environment. With an impressive carehome.co.uk review score of 9.6 out of 10, Richmond Village Letcombe Regis is recognized for its commitment to excellence in residential care.

Advantages for Prospective Candidates:

  • Competitive Remuneration and Benefits: The role offers an attractive hourly rate of £13.20, with the added benefit of paid breaks, ensuring you are compensated for your entire working time. A £500 welcome bonus is also provided to new hires, acknowledging your commitment to joining the Bupa team.
  • Flexible Working Arrangements: Bupa understands the importance of work-life balance and offers both full-time and part-time positions. The 12-hour shift pattern (08:00-20:00 or 20:00-08:00), including alternative weekends, allows for structured work schedules.
  • Comprehensive Wellbeing Programme: Bupa's global wellbeing initiative, Viva, supports your mental, physical, financial, social, and environmental health. This is complemented by:
    • My Healthcare: 24/7 access to remote GP services, physiotherapy, mental health support, and expert advice.
    • Annual Healthcare Allowance: Approximately £350 to spend on Bupa healthcare products.
    • Free Meals: A complimentary meal is provided with every shift.
    • Generous Holiday Entitlement: 28 days of holiday, with additional days awarded for long service.
    • Interest-Free Travel Loan: For the purchase of annual public transport season tickets.
    • Wagestream Access: The ability to access up to 40% of your earned wages early.
    • Competitive Pension Plans and Parental Leave: Robust options for your long-term financial security and family needs, including a dedicated Menopause plan.
    • My Bupa Extras: Discounts at various retailers and wellbeing resources.
    • Sick Pay Scheme: Additional support for frontline teams during longer absences.
  • Commitment to Personal Growth: Bupa fosters a culture of continuous learning and innovation. You will be encouraged to develop your skills and contribute to a positive and collaborative team environment.
  • Meaningful Work: This role directly contributes to Bupa's purpose of helping people live longer, healthier, happier lives. You'll be at the forefront of providing compassionate care and ensuring residents feel valued and supported.
  • Diversity and Inclusion: Bupa champions diversity and actively encourages applications from individuals with diverse backgrounds and experiences. As a Level 2 Disability Confident Employer, they are committed to providing fair opportunities and reasonable adjustments for disabled applicants.

Key Considerations for Candidates:

  • Role Responsibilities: The core of this role involves providing high-standard clinical, social, and emotional care to residents. This includes recognizing and meeting individual needs, assisting with personal care, and acting as a companion.
  • Team Collaboration: You will work closely with nurses and senior care assistants, playing a vital role in monitoring residents' conditions and reporting any changes. Effective communication with residents' families and other healthcare professionals is also essential.
  • Adaptability: The ability to adapt to a range of resident needs, from companionship to more complex personal care, is crucial. A genuine passion for caregiving and a compassionate nature will be paramount.
  • Commitment to Excellence: Richmond Village Letcombe Regis prides itself on its high standards. Candidates should be driven to deliver exceptional care and contribute to maintaining the village's outstanding reputation.
  • Shift Work: The 12-hour shifts, including weekend work, require a commitment to a structured and potentially demanding schedule.

This Care Assistant position at Richmond Village Letcombe Regis presents a compelling opportunity for individuals seeking a fulfilling career in the care sector. The combination of excellent benefits, a supportive work environment, and the chance to positively impact residents' lives makes this a role worth serious consideration for those passionate about making a difference.
